get the coaches from the backend

This commit is contained in:
Andreas Zweili 2021-07-28 17:01:33 +02:00
parent 4665d05bfa
commit 2dcd26709f
1 changed files with 7 additions and 1 deletions

View File

@ -5,7 +5,7 @@
<base-card>
<section>
<div class="controls">
<base-button mode="outline">Refresh</base-button>
<base-button mode="outline" @click="loadCoaches">Refresh</base-button>
<base-button v-if="!isCoach" link to="/register"
>Register as Coach</base-button
>
@ -64,9 +64,15 @@ export default {
return this.$store.getters['coaches/hasCoaches'];
}
},
created() {
this.loadCoaches();
},
methods: {
setFilter(updatedFilters) {
this.activeFilters = updatedFilters;
},
loadCoaches() {
this.$store.dispatch('coaches/loadCoaches');
}
}
};